A Horse Called War - Good For Glue (And Nothing Else)

When A Horse Called War re-emerged after more than a decade away, Good For Glue (And Nothing Else) was the statement they chose to make. Released in November 2019 on APF Records, this five-track EP marked the first new music from the East Anglian sludge collective since 2007’s Stumble At Every Hurdle.

From the opening assault of Dog Is Dead through to the crushing finale of Woodpusher, the record captures the band’s signature blend of sludge, doom, crust and stoner grit – a sound as uncompromising as their name suggests. Recorded, mixed and mastered by guitarist Dave at Bomb Store Studios, it delivers thick riffs, lurching grooves and raw, visceral vocals that shift from hardcore bellows to gang chants and snarling spoken passages. Tracks like Old One Eye and Don Frye demonstrate their knack for balancing sheer heaviness with dynamic changes in tempo and texture, never letting the chaos descend into monotony.

Good For Glue (And Nothing Else) isn’t just a return – it’s a reassertion. A Horse Called War pick up the torch once carried by the UK sludge underground of Iron Monkey and Charger, while proving they’ve carved out their own identity in the modern heavy landscape. Released in limited digipak CD and cassette editions with artwork by Wesley K Brown – both now sold out – the EP stands as a fierce reminder of why this band mattered before, and why they matter again.
